Celebrity Chef: Samme Guo & Terry Yeh
Wed, June 04 2008
Samme Guo & Terry Yeh Restaurant: Applause Japanese Restaurant Signature Dish: BBQ Black Cod Training: They both worked at Richmond’s Japanese restaurant Daimasu, but at different times. Favorite Fast Food: "Food court combo, beef or chicken teriyaki," says Guo. "I would choose Burger Kings," admits Yeh. Years in the Industry: Guo has been in the industry for 18 years; Yeh, 13 years. Defining Dining in Vancouver: "Great! You are able to try all different kinds of food from terrific chefs from all over the world," says Guo. "Lots of fresh food and a lot of variety," adds Yeh. Home Cooking Tip: Yeh’s cooking must is, "always use fresh food" while Guo insists, "never add too much salt."
Secret Recipe . . . Beef Teriyaki
Sauce: 1cup soy sauce 1cup water 1 cup sugar 2 teaspoons Sake 2 teaspoons Mirin Boil until sauce thickens, approximately 10-30 minutes. If needed, add cornstarch to thicken.
Meat: In a separate pan, fry beef in oil until it changes color. Approximately 1-2 minutes. Add vegetables of choice. Stir in sauce. Table for Two?
